Output e68964ba3bbcbe1733d34683f06812a7eba84c2fd7da45be67b35770c6b24980:4

value
524000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b76ae6c659329fdf38fd18cb2b88acc1994bcd9 OP_EQUAL
address
377Rxz8taWqnWi1vSnS1pnhDuPELomee6R
transaction
e68964ba3bbcbe1733d34683f06812a7eba84c2fd7da45be67b35770c6b24980
spent
true